博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
【jQuery】----jQuery 多个库之间的冲突 (二)
阅读量:6996 次
发布时间:2019-06-27

本文共 590 字,大约阅读时间需要 1 分钟。

hot3.png

<!--在html引入js库-->
<script type="text/javascript" src="jquery-1.10.1.js"/>
<script type="text/javascript" src="base.js"/>
<!--在html引入css样式文件-->
<link rel="stylesheet" href="style.css" type="text/css">

————————————————————————————

例如:jquery和base.js库,都使用 “$”座位基准起始符。

1、jquery库在base库之前引入,那么“$”的所有权就归base库所有。
    而jquery可以直接用jquery对象调用,或者创建一个“$$” 符号给jquery使用
    var $$=jQuery;

2、jquery库在base库之后引入,那么“$”的所有权就归jQuery库所有.

       而base库将会冲突失去作用。这里jQuery提供了一个方法
        jQuery.noConfict();//将$所有权 剔除,这样$就属于base库了
        var $$=jQuery;
        $(function(){
                $//调用base的方法 
               $$ //调用jquery的方法
        })
 

转载于:https://my.oschina.net/lsl1991/blog/1536038

你可能感兴趣的文章